  NHTSA Recall 16V842000

NHTSA Campaign Id 16V842000; Date: Nov. 21, 2016

If the trailer brake lights stay illuminated while being used, other drivers may be confused, increasing the risk of a crash.

icon1 Recalled Vehicles:

2017 Hyundai Santa Fe 2016 Hyundai Tucson 2017 Hyundai Tucson

Component: Electrical System:wiring

Manufactured by: Hyundai Motor America

Affected Units:: 6,172

icon3 Recall Summary:

Hyundai mot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ain model year 2016-2017 tucson vehicles manufactured may 19, 2015, to November 14, 2016, and 2017 santa fe vehicles manufactured November 28, 2015, to November 14, 2016. The affected vehicles may be equipped with an accessory trailer hitch wiring harness that, due to a malfunction of the tow hitch module, may result, in the trailer brake lights being constantly illuminated.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of federal motor vehicle safety standard (fmvss) number 108, " lamps, reflective devices, and associated equipment. "

icon2 How to Fix:

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will replace the affected accessory trailer hitch wiring harnesses, free of charge. The recall is expected to begin January 13, 2017.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-800-633-5151. Hyundai's number for this recall is 153.
